Senior Sales Support Associate (NYC Hybrid) Job Locations US-NY-New York Category Sales Ops Overview Are you a highly organized, proactive person?
Are you interested in learning more about the trade and international sides of the publishing business, while working with a variety of departments in an essential role?
Our Sales Ops team is hiring a Senior Sales Support Associate to help with the key behind-the-scenes work of getting physical and digital books to stores and to readers all over the world!
This position will be involved in coordination of our international editions, local prints program, and our global sister offices. The position will interact with many parts of the business including Sales Directors, international vendors, and our Publishing teams in key day-to-day responsibilities.
A great next step for individuals looking to grow in an Operations career.
Responsibilities Under minimal supervision, works under the direction of the Associate Director, Sales Operations, providing support for the international edition program, including setting up titles, soliciting projections, and synchronization with departments on Sales Ops logistics and tracking editions with Sales team.
Facilitates the operational directives of local print initiatives, partnering with production and cross-functional teams to manage schedules, P&Ls, project milestones, and communications.
Administers the international promotional pricing program and serves as the Sales Operations lead for production and inventory coordination across the International Sales group.
Supports the print-on-demand program while overseeing competitive publisher tracking and coordination of HCUK/HCUS shared title initiatives.
Acts as the primary Sales Operations liaison for system-related processes and enhancements, partnering with cross-functional teams to resolve issues and improve operational efficiency.
Provides senior-level operational support on departmental initiatives, special projects, and presentations.
Qualifications 3+ years of experience; prior publishing or project management experience a plus Detail-oriented, well-organized, able to set priorities and juggle multiple projects under pressure Ability to maintain complicated schedules involving multiple projects and stakeholders Knowledge of Excel and other Microsoft products and ability to learn a variety of company systems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Must possess college degree or equivalent work experience HarperCollins Publishers is a company full of people who are passionate about books.
